A RANDOMIZED CLINICAL TRIAL COMPARING EFFICACY OF VITRECTOMY WITH INTRA VITREAL TRIAMCINOLONE ACETONIDE INJECTION AND SIMPLE VITRECTOMY IN PATIENTS WITH VITREOUS HAEMORRHAGE DUE TO PROLIFERATIVE DIABETIC RETINOPATHY

Journal Title: Journal of Evolution of Medical and Dental Sciences - Year 2013, Vol 2, Issue 21

Abstract

 Proliferative diabetic retinopathy affects about 5-10%of the diabetic population. It is the advanced form of the disease due to ischemic changes and this indicates progression towards more devastating form ie; end stage diabetic eye disease leading to total blindness. The conventional treatment of this disease has been with laser photocoagulation of the ischemic areas. Serious vision threatening complications of diabetic retinopathy (Advanced Diabetic Eye Disease [ADED]) occur in patients who have not had laser therapy or in whom laser therapy has been unsuccessful. In these groups of patients the treatment is vitrectomy with varying results in regaining and maintaining the regained vision. So Intra Vitreal triamcinolone Acetonide [IVTA] injection has been tried in many centres, because of its anti inflammatory, anti angiogenic, cell migration inhibition properties. In this context to study the efficacy of intravitreal triamcinolone against simple vitrectomy was considered. The comparison of two modes of therapy is best done by a Randomized Controlled Trial. Such studies are not reported from elsewhere in India. Hence this study.
